HomeMy WebLinkAboutKaʻū CDP Action Committee Fact SheetKAʻŪ COMMUNITY DEVELOPMENT PLAN (CDP) ACTION COMMITTEE (AC) Updated: December 31, 2025 PURPOSE: The purpose of the CDP Action Committee is to be a proactive, community-based steward responsible for implementing resident-driven solutions from the Community Development Plan that positively transform the community in partnership with a network of businesses, non-profits, and community leaders. AUTHORITY: Hawai‘i County Code, Chapter 16 FULL MEMBERSHIP: Nine members SPECIFIC REPRESENTATION: Primary residence must be in the Planning area of the CDP. REQUIRED COMMITMENTS: Possess a deep love for their community; a passion for equity; and a motivation to work for the greater good of their community. Commit to a term of up to four years; attend regular meetings; invest a minimum of 8 hours of work each month advancing CDP implementation; organize/attend public meetings, workshops, and trainings; identify capacity building needs and opportunities within community; and agree to follow rules and operating principles of the committee and the Planning Department. Commit to intentionally and explicitly engaging all factions of the community equitably while working to develop partnerships with individuals, non-profits, businesses, and community groups/associations to implement grass roots actions; serve as a point of contact for CDP and AC initiatives; and transmit project updates and opportunities to community within the CDP region. MEETINGS: Meetings are scheduled as required to address new and existing actions.
